How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wood County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wood County Studio Apartments | $700 | $700 | $700 |
Wood County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$719 | $642 | $941 |
Wood County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$844 | $570 | $1,050 |
Wood County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$965 | $650 | $1,350 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wood County
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wood County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wood County ranges from $642 to $941 with an average monthly rent of $719.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wood County c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wood County range from $570 to $1,050.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$844.
How expensive are Wood County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 20 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wood County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$650 to $1,350 - averaging $965 for the location.
